In a heartfelt message released today, Catherine, the Princess of Wales, shared the uplifting news that she has completed her chemotherapy treatment.
After a challenging nine months, the Princess expressed deep gratitude for reaching this significant milestone in her journey towards recovery.
In her personal message, the Princess described the cancer battle as a “complex, scary and unpredictable” journey, not just for her, but for those closest to her. She candidly reflected on how her illness had brought her face to face with her own vulnerabilities, offering a humbling new perspective on life.
Princess Catherine, known for her unwavering dedication to public service, acknowledged that this difficult chapter had reminded both her and Prince William of the importance of “the simple yet important things in life,” particularly the power of love and support from family and friends.
Although she has finished chemotherapy, the Princess stressed that her road to recovery is far from over. She plans to take each day as it comes, focusing on staying cancer-free. Despite the ongoing challenges, she looks forward to resuming some public duties in the coming months, expressing a renewed sense of hope and appreciation for life.
The message also conveyed her profound gratitude to the public for their kindness and support during this difficult time. The compassion she and her family have received has been, in her words, “truly humbling.”
In a touching conclusion, the Princess extended her solidarity to others who are facing similar battles, offering words of encouragement: “To all those who are continuing their own cancer journey – I remain with you, side by side, hand in hand. Out of darkness, can come light, so let that light shine bright.”
